RND1 Antibody / Rho-related GTP-binding protein Rho6

  • Description:

    RND1 is a small signaling G protein (to be specific, a GTPase), and is a member of the Rnd subgroup of the Rho family of GTPases. Members of this family regulate the organization of the actin cytoskeleton in response to extracellular growth factors. A similar protein in rat interacts with a microtubule regulator to control axon extension. The RND1 gene is mapped to chromosome 12q12-q13.
